Publix Recalls Jalapeño Bagels

MIAMI (CBSMiami) - Publix is voluntarily recalling their store brand jalapeño bagels, which were sold in either the self-service bins or artisan cases in the bakery department, because they may contain pieces of glass and small stones.

The Publix Jalapeño Bagels were distributed to Publix store locations in Florida, Alabama, Georgia and South Carolina. Publix stores in Tennessee and North Carolina are not impacted by this recall. Publix was made aware of this potential product hazard by the supplier.

"As part of our commitment to food safety, potentially impacted product has been removed from all affected bakery departments," said Maria Brous, Publix media and community relations director.

There have been no reported cases of illness or injury. Consumers who have purchased the bagels may return them for a full refund.
